Bill Clinton Endorses Obama Like a Three-Year-Old Endorses Brussel Sprouts
Bill Clinton appeared on Meet the Press yesterday, presumably as a stand-in for Sean Hannity and Baroness Lynn Forester de Rothschild.What follows is a list of quotes spoken by the former President on yesterday's show. Figure out whether he was talking about a) Barack Obama, b) John McCain, c) George W. Bush or d) Sarah Palin.
1. I have never concealed my admiration and affection for [blank]. I think he's a great man.
2. …People from your native state, in South Dakota, and people in Arkansas, and they look at [blank], and they say, "You know, this is a pretty impressive deal."
3. And in the world, the places where America is popular today in the world, really popular, 10 countries in central and eastern Africa… Why? Because they see us through the prism of [blank]'s AIDS and malaria programs…
4. I mean, he was, you know, until he was in the State Senate until 2005 and then he began a campaign for president, [sic] which is, in all probability, will be successful, and those are very great accomplishments. But those are personal accomplishments.
Answers: The first three were about himself and the last one was about Dick Cheney.
In reality, it was 1-b, 2-d, 3-c, 4-a.
And on quote number four, he had his fingers crossed.
